About

Tennessee schoolteacher famous for his involvement in the Scopes Monkey Trial of the 1920s.

Trivia

He famously challenged Tennessee's Butler Act, which forbade the teaching of evolution.

Associated With

His legal defense team included the famous ACLU lawyer Clarence Darrow.
